Southern Colorado's Home for Purple Heart Recipients & their families

MOPH Chapter 423 is the largest MOPH chapter in Colorado, with over 330 members spanning multiple generations: World War II, the Korean War, the Vietnam War, and the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an. We share an unbreakable bond forged in battle: shedding blood in the service of our great nation.

Chartered on 27 February 1977, MOPH Chapter 423 serves Southern Colorado’s combat wounded veterans and their families. We have a long, storied history of helping Colorado’s needy veterans and their families. We welcome you to join our MOPH family, a place of camaraderie, compassion, fun, and shared purpose.

HELP US HELP OUR FELLOW VETERANS

A key part of our mission is helping our community’s needy veterans and their families. We provide a range of services including homeless and at-risk veteran support services, care packages for veterans in long-term care facilities, and college and vocational scholarships for Purple Heart recipients and their family members and descendants.
